Check the tyre sidewall for a size like 215/60 R16, look in the driver door jamb sticker, or use your V5C and handbook. If you enter your registration in the search tool, it can show options that match your vehicle details.
The UK legal minimum is 1.6mm across the central 3/4 of the tread around the full circumference. Many drivers replace sooner, around 3mm for summer tyres, to maintain wet grip and braking performance.
It is legal if the tyres are the same size and meet the required load and speed ratings, but it is best practice to fit matching tyres on the same axle. If your T-Roc is 4MOTION, keeping tread depths similar across all four tyres can help avoid drivetrain strain.
Summer tyres suit warmer months and normal UK conditions, winter tyres improve traction below about 7C, and all-season tyres are a popular year-round option for mixed weather. Your best choice depends on where you drive and whether you regularly face ice, snow or steep rural roads.
